SOURCE: The chime stopped working if

First you did not mention trim level or what radio you have asuming you have a RDS radio system since you mentioned your radio did in fact work that gives me the impression you do nt have a WT or base model. If in fact you have a RDS radio the chime only chimes on the one driverside speaker (large one in door not the tweeter) See if that speaker is opperational. If it is opperational and you have the controlls on the steering wheel locate your owners manual and see how to enable the chimes or disable the chime. You or someone may have disabled the chime. Try these two posibilities if they dont work resubmit and I will look into problem farther, it may be in the radio itself.

My 2008 chevy impala has intermittent speakers on 3 or the 4 main speakers. both front and right rear stop working and then start again. also the chimes for keys in the ignition also are intermittent. ...

Well its most likely a bad connection at the ignition switch a lose or corroded blade or female connector not a main power wire .Or a connection at the radio it self .
Problems like this ie .electrical problems seam hard to understand at first . But what you need to do is look at the problem 3 speakers intermittent yet they work sometimes the chime for the key same .
I would pull the radio fuse out of the fuse box first if the chime problem goes away the problem is likely a connection on the back of the radio or corresponding wiring connections .If not then you need to look at the ignition and door switch door open door closed .
In short don't ripe things apart its much cheaper and easier to test then form a plain . You may need to buy a cheap tester or meter have fun with it.

Reset message center window

THIS SHOULD HELP YOU

Turn the ignition to ON without starting the engine. Fully press and release the accelerator pedal three times within five seconds. If the CHG OIL SOON light flashes two times, the system is resetting. Turn the key to OFF, then start the vehicle. If the CHG OIL SOON light comes back on, the system has not reset, repeat the procedure. Follow this procedure to reset the GM Oil Life System using the DE 100 Series Radio®. Turn the ignition to ACC or ON and the radio off. Press and hold the DISP button on the radio for at least five seconds until SETTINGS is displayed. Press the SEEK up or down arrow to scroll through the main menu. Scroll until OIL LIFE appears on the display. Press the PREV or NEXT button to enter the submenu. RESET will be displayed. Press the DISP button to reset. A chime will be heard to verify the new setting and DONE will be displayed for one second. Once the message has been reset, scroll until EXIT appears on the display. Press the DISP button to exit programming. A chime will be heard to verify the exit.
